Chad Molnar is the LAX-Community
Liaison, a position developed by Los Angeles World
Airports (LAWA) and the City Council to provide Council
District 11 communities with accurate and objective
information regarding LAX modernization and the airport's
impacts on the surrounding neighborhoods, and to inform
LAWA regarding the concerns of those communities.
Chad is experienced in understanding and addressing
constituent concerns with large transportation hubs,
having previously served as Congresswoman Jane Harman's
District Director and top advisor on issues surrounding
the Port of Los Angeles. He is a political veteran,
having managed several campaigns for Congress and the
state legislature.
The first in his Cuban family to be born in the United
States, Chad is fluent in Spanish and a transplant
from the East Coast. He is a graduate of the
University of Massachusetts with a B.A. in Political
Science.
